Lavrov: The Council of Europe was powerless in the investigation of the fire in the House of Trade Unions in Odessa. 48 people died that day, 42 of whom were in the house, and more than 250 were injured.

“No investigation was carried out, it was all just in words,” Lavrov said. The tragedy occurred on May 2, 2014, as a result of a clash between supporters and opponents of the Euromaidan, pro-Ukrainian activists and nationalists destroyed the camp.
